During spring break, families of Southside Students may request a free school meal pick up. A drive-up event will be held on Monday, March 22, 2021. The box will contain 5 days of school meals (breakfast and lunch). Meals can be picked up between 10:00 am and 12:00 pm.

Through collaborative efforts with Wilson Wil-Sav Pharmacy, teachers and Staff of Southside Schools were able to receive the first dose of the COVID-19 Vaccine. The staff of the pharmacy worked with school nurses Maggie Henderson, Tifney Roberts, and Leea Godush to provide a vaccination clinic onsite at our school. We appreciate the team effort to protect the safety of our staff, school, and community. #BetterTogether

Press Release! In the board meeting tonight the Southside School Board regretfully accepted the resignation of Superintendent Roger Rich effective at the end of the current school year. With 30 years invested in education, Mr. Rich has served the patrons of the Southside School District for over 20 years. In the same meeting they announced the selection of Assistant Superintendent Mr. Dion Stevens, as the next superintendent of the Southside School District. Congratulations to Mr. Stevens! Good luck in your retirement, Mr. Rich!
